At Delaware: Expected to battle Alli Kurtz for the starting spot in the Blue Hen goal.
2007: Appeared in and started eight matches in the Delaware goal • ranked fifth in the Colonial Athletic Association with 4.88 saves per game, seventh with an .812 save percentage, ninth with a 1.20 goals against average, and tied for ninth with three shutouts • posted shutouts in her first three appearances of the season against Marshall, Seton Hall and Texas - San Antonio • recorded a career-high nine saves at Towson • stopped seven shots at UTSA while adding six versus Old Dominion and James Madison • named to CAA Academic Honor Roll.
2006: Made first career appearance in the second half against Drexel • allowed one goal and made three saves in 22:13 of action.
2005: Sat out the season and maintained freshman eligibility.
High School: Four-year starter at Owen J. Roberts High School • led team to the state championship in 2003 • first team all-area as junior and senior • second team all-area as a freshman and sophomore • set Pennsylvania state record for career shutouts with 58 • tied teammate Lindsey Shover for Pennsylvania record with 19 consecutive shutouts • team captain as a senior • also played lacrosse as a freshman and sophomore • member of National Honor Society.
